Cost of assisted living in W Bloomfield Twp, Michigan
Studio | 1 Bedroom | 2 Bedrooms | Semi-Private |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Independent Living | $4,000 | $4,998 | $4,510 | $4,488 |
Assisted Living | $4,432 | $4,757 | $4,900 | $3,973 |
Memory Care | $4,863 | $5,137 | $4,900 | $4,315 |
* Prices shown are average monthly costs within a 20-mile radius
